Biographical profile of Herbert Clark Hoover, 31st President of the United States, a man whose reputation as one of the world's greatest humanitarians plummeted with the advent of the Great Depression during his administration. Prior to his presidency, Hoover was lionized by many for saving millions of lives in Europe during World War I.
